Model & Market Context

This airframe, registered as N701FR, is an Airbus A321-200 (A321-211) built in 2015 with manufacturer serial number 6793. The aircraft is registered in the US and is recorded as owned by UMB BANK NA TRUSTEE, a corporate trustee based in Salt Lake City, UT, US, reflecting a financial-asset ownership structure rather than direct airline operation. The record indicates a high-density configuration and a mid-life age profile for an airliner of this type, with an estimated market valuation of $27,000,000 and status consistent with commercial passenger service or lease placement. Operator and home base details are not published in the supplied data.

The aircraft is outfitted in a high-density single-class cabin, accommodating approximately 230 economy seats, optimized for short- to medium-haul high-capacity operations. Avionics fit and detailed interior specifications are not published in the supplied data; however, the high-density layout implies simplified galley and lavatory provisioning and a focus on maximizing revenue seats per flight. Typical mission profiles for this configuration include dense domestic or regional trunk routes within the aircraft’s 3,213 nm range at cruise speeds near 447 kts, enabling multiple daily sectors. Maintenance considerations for this specific airframe center on lifecycle management of the twin CFM56-5B3 engines and airframe wear consistent with a 2015 build year, plus regulatory oversight associated with trustee-owned aircraft intended for lease or sale.

As an Airbus A321-200 airframe, this example sits in the single-aisle, high-capacity niche offering extended range relative to earlier narrowbody variants while carrying a large passenger load in dense layouts. The combination of a 2015 build year, common CFM56 powerplants, and a high-density 230-seat cabin supports demand from low-cost carriers and high-density charter operators, while the recorded valuation of $27,000,000 reflects market conditions for mid-life A321-200s configured for economy-only service. Resale and lease prospects for this airframe will be influenced by engine maintenance status, interior refurbishment needs, and the asset-holder’s trustee-driven disposition strategy.
